Akuse

Akuse is a town in the Lower Manya Krobo district of the of situated between Tema and Akosombo. It is a fast growing community thanks to a number of companies operating from the area which is attracting skill and capital.

Dam
The , also known as the Akuse Dam, is a hydroelectric power generating dam on the lower near Akuse in . It is owned and operated by Volta River Authority. is situated 3½ km north of Akuse.
